“Miss Universe” (宇宙小姐) is the first promotional track from Taiwanese pop group S.H.E’s latest album “FM S.H.E”. The album is their first in more than a year and will be officially released on September 23. Music video below…
Miss Universe is a cover for Jade Valerie’s “Crush”, which was original done as a duet with Korean singer Baek Ji-young in May 2007.

You might be right… I don’t think the Chinese artists will be as enthusiast as the Koreans when it comes to US venture though.
Japan probably have the 2nd largest domestic music market behind US, and the Chinese market is showing plenty of potential with the huge mainland China market. The Koreans however are having the dilemma domestically…
While the Japanese and Chinese best sellers are in million(s) of copies, the best sellers in Korea are often less than 300k. They have no choice but to try expanding oversea… and US probably have the largest Korean population outside of Korea.
